Verizon Wireless Expanding Coverage from Coast to Coast!

Verizon Wireless

Even though Verizon Wireless is not the nation's leading cell phone carrier, they are greatly expanding their coverage to give their existing customers better coverage. While the "Can you hear me now" commercials are amusing, is it really amusing when you constantly drop calls.

In an article I read last month, a few of the major cell phone carriers were getting rid of their analog service, so it wasn’t at all surprising to me that Verizon Wireless is putting up new cell sites.

One of the new cell sites has been placed in Gibsonia, Pennsylvania. Not only will the new cell site improve reception along State Route 8, it will also improve reception in Wildwood.

Two new cell sites have also been erected in De Soto Missouri. These two towers will greatly improve voice and data calls along Routes 67 & 110.

With expansion already underway, it most likely won’t be long before a new cell site comes to your neck of the woods.
